In Microsoft Word, the tool that helps you find a synonym is the Thesaurus. You can access it by right-clicking on a word and selecting "Synonyms" from the context menu, or by going to the "Review" tab and clicking on "Thesaurus." This feature provides alternative words with similar meanings, allowing you to enhance your writing.

To insert the parallel symbol (∥) in Microsoft Word, you can use the Symbol feature. Go to the "Insert" tab, click on "Symbol," and then select "More Symbols." In the Symbol dialog box, find the parallel symbol in the list, select it, and click "Insert." Alternatively, you can type the Unicode for the symbol (U+2225) followed by pressing "Alt" + "X" to convert it into the parallel symbol.
